Output e6162b8576fc34fed564a30f44e2f9e8160cab078428d6c227d82d74205d6944:5

value
17435770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425818ac52579068ad11b598404317e705b03ad4 OP_EQUAL
address
MDwxN8mYPnGSMZ1FQe7qg5xFyhdbDLg2Zk
transaction
e6162b8576fc34fed564a30f44e2f9e8160cab078428d6c227d82d74205d6944
spent
true